Description
This is an 18th-century pair of buildings located on Whitstable Road. The buildings are constructed of painted brick, with the first floor clad in tile hanging. They have a mansard roof covered in tiles, featuring two dormers. The windows are 2-light sashes with vertical glazing bars only. The doorcases are simple in design. Buildings 12 to 24 (even numbers) form a notable group.
